### Secure Interview Room — Facilities Desk Notes

Room 3B at Thornway Place is reserved for candidate interviews and must be kept locked between bookings. Facilities staff should check the room each morning: clear the whiteboard, remove any paperwork, and confirm the recording light is off. Bookings come through the Larkspur calendar; do not admit anyone not listed. When preparing the room ahead of an interview, unlock it using the keypad code below.

turnstile pass: bdg-FVNQRS-72965873

Subject: Quorra Systems — acquisition feasibility

Team,

Initial diligence on Quorra Systems wraps Friday. Their pipeline overlaps ours in the Veltane region; margins look thin but client retention is strong. Do not mention this externally. Sales leads: keep pursuing Quorra's accounts as normal competitors until told otherwise. Valuation range and deal structure are still under negotiation. Key terms under discussion follow.

management briefing: The renewal with Zoraelax Group closes at $10 million a year, 15 percent below the last contract. Project Ralael slips by six weeks because of the audit delay.

Ticket: Customer record deduplication in the Larkfield CRM. Welcome aboard — please read carefully before merging anything. Duplicates must be matched on normalized name plus postal fields, never on phone alone. Merges are irreversible in Larkfield, so each batch requires explicit sign-off before execution. Once your candidate list is ready, request approval from the person named below.

account owner for bawip-tahag: Raleth Quenok

## Runbook: Shorewatch tide-table widget

If the widget shows stale tide predictions, first check the upstream feed poller rather than the renderer. The poller caches harmonic constants for each station, and a stuck cache is the usual culprit. Restart the poller only after confirming the cache timestamp is older than six hours. The poller reads the following configuration at startup.

service settings:
druath:
  pin: 7832
  metrics_host: metrics.druath.tolvaqlabs.internal
  tenant: eliix
  seal: seal_01c421e1